With idyllic beaches and peaceful wildlife preserves, Virginia is full of historic landmarks. Discover the expansive outdoors, hop to some top-tier museums, or learn about the state's colorful history in its cities.

Immerse yourself in the unfettered beauty of the Shenandoah Valley, which rolls through the Blue Ridge and Allegheny mountain ranges. Hike or camp throughout the area for wonderful countryside views complete with rugged mountain peaks and farmland. If your family is looking for a swimming getaway, head over to Assateague Island National Seashore, which boasts a beach filled with wilderness, lush pine forests, and marshes. Kids will love to snap pictures of wild animals such as white tailed deer, snow geese, and the island’s famous wild ponies.

Rocket off to The Virginia Air and Space Center, which outlines the history of the astronauts and the American space program. Your kids will enjoy learning about far away galaxies and pretend they're astronauts in the exploratory exhibitions. If you have a sailing enthusiast in the family, the Mariner’s Museum in Newport is a great place to check out ship models, figureheads, and small crafts for viewing. Visit the town of Norfolk, where your family can smell the fresh sea air and walk around the naval base. With other experiences like the Frontier Culture Museum, the historic lifestyle of early immigrant pioneers will fascinate children of all ages.

Explore Virginia's vibrant cities, where both history and fun come together. Kids interested in arts and crafts will adore visiting Alexandria, which hosts the Torpedo Factory with some of the region’s well-known potters, jewelers, weavers, and photographers. The famous Arlington National Cemetery is the resting spot for John F. Kennedy and the Unknown Soldier, and isn't a far drive from Alexandria. Monumental battlefields located in Fredericksburg, Chancelorsville, and Manassas will give your little ones an opportunity to see what the era was like. Check out Robert E. Lee's untouched office in the Shenandoah area, which is sure to impress. Whether you want to stop by Lexington to go horseback riding or just walk around the streets of colonial Williamsburg, Virginia is steeped in a compelling amount of history for any child's curiosity.
